Original WW2 era famous US Navy Mark 2 “Ka-Bar” fighting knife (the link is a courtesy of Wikipedia) manufactured early in the war by PAL Cutlery.  This is the scarce and desirable early-production “red spacer” type Mark 2 with USN-designated blade. MK2 is a classic American WW2 era fighting knife; this type was used in combat by the US Army and the Navy men alike in all theaters of the War.

This is the hard-to-find first-issue “red spacer” type – only the early-production knives had fancy colored fiber spacer; these were quickly done away with to simplify the wartime production and reduce costs. In 1940 PAL Cutlery has purchased the cutlery division of Remington Arms and moved old Remington equipment and knife stock to Holyoke, MA.  Not to miss a good business opportunity, PAL had re-purposed old Remington blades as “private purchase” fighting knives for the American GIs and began manufacturing knives using the left-over stock parts with the Remington emblem (RH stands for Remington Hunter). These “PAL-RH” knives were quite popular with the troops and many thousands were sold.

This specimen is in very good overall condition, considering the age; all  early early US Navy-designated “red spacer” Mark 2s are pretty hard to find nowadays. This MK2 is about 12″ / 30.5 cm overall; the blade is about 6-7/8″ / 17.5 cm long. The knife is used but it’s in better than average condition for the type. The blade has not been cleaned, it’s razor-sharp still, including the “false” upper edge; the end of the tip is nicked. The blade has surface rust near the top from poor storage – looks like salt water exposure to me (cleanable).  Ricasso is stamped PAL RH-37 . MADE IN USA on one side and U.S. NAVY on the other. Stacked leather washers handle with red and black fiber spacers on both ends. An early double-thickness threaded round hammer-like steel pommel and slightly curved handguard. The handle is tight; the guard and the top spacer have a bit of a play; no typical ding marks on the pommel or the spine of the blade – scarce as such.

Original navy-gray NORD composition scabbard was manufactured during the war by Beckwith Manufacturing division of Victory Plastics. Production numbers on the back of the throat indicate June 1944 delivery to the US Navy. The scabbard is in very good overall condition; the webbing is in great shape; no cuts, holes, or mold stains; the keeper is intact and tight; one thin rib crack close to the tip  is noted for accuracy.
